History log of /illumos-gate/usr/src/uts/common/os/devcfg.c (Results 1 – 25 of 79)
Revision Date Author Comments
# 5f61829a 09-Nov-2022 Robert Mustacchi

15163 ldi_open family should admit constness
Reviewed by: Gordon Ross <gordon.w.ross@gmail.com>
Reviewed by: Patrick Mooney <pmooney@pfmooney.com>
Reviewed by: Andrew Stormont <andyjstorm

15163 ldi_open family should admit constness
Reviewed by: Gordon Ross <gordon.w.ross@gmail.com>
Reviewed by: Patrick Mooney <pmooney@pfmooney.com>
Reviewed by: Andrew Stormont <andyjstormont@gmail.com>
Approved by: Dan McDonald <danmcd@mnx.io>

show more ...


# 3fe80ca4 15-Mar-2023 Dan Cross

15483 remove circular from ndi_devi_enter et al
Reviewed by: Andy Fiddaman <illumos@fiddaman.net>
Reviewed by: Robert Mustacchi <rm@fingolfin.org>
Approved by: Dan McDonald <danmcd@mnx.io>


# d27aea3f 02-Mar-2023 Dan Cross

15463 ndi_devi_enter et al can be safer and clearer
Reviewed by: Andy Fiddaman <illumos@fiddaman.net>
Reviewed by: Robert Mustacchi <rm+illumos@fingolfin.org>
Reviewed by: Gordon Ross <Go

15463 ndi_devi_enter et al can be safer and clearer
Reviewed by: Andy Fiddaman <illumos@fiddaman.net>
Reviewed by: Robert Mustacchi <rm+illumos@fingolfin.org>
Reviewed by: Gordon Ross <Gordon.W.Ross@gmail.com>
Approved by: Dan McDonald <danmcd@mnx.io>

show more ...


# b31f5cf7 16-Feb-2023 Dan Cross

15395 ndi_devi_enter deadlock: di_copytree et al vs hotplug
Reviewed by: Robert Mustacchi <rm@fingolfin.org>
Reviewed by: Keith M Wesolowski <wesolows@oxide.computer>
Reviewed by: Dan McD

15395 ndi_devi_enter deadlock: di_copytree et al vs hotplug
Reviewed by: Robert Mustacchi <rm@fingolfin.org>
Reviewed by: Keith M Wesolowski <wesolows@oxide.computer>
Reviewed by: Dan McDonald <danmcd@mnx.io>
Approved by: Gordon Ross <gordon.w.ross@gmail.com>

show more ...


# 3ce53722 05-Apr-2020 Robert Mustacchi

12830 Want centralized ksensor framework
12831 temperature sensors could describe accuracy
12832 topo support for generic PCI device temp sensors
Reviewed by: Ryan Zezeski <ryan@zinascii.

12830 Want centralized ksensor framework
12831 temperature sensors could describe accuracy
12832 topo support for generic PCI device temp sensors
Reviewed by: Ryan Zezeski <ryan@zinascii.com>
Reviewed by: Toomas Soome <toomas@me.com>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# 6205b5c4 08-Apr-2020 Robert Mustacchi

12508 ndi_devi_alloc() and friends could take const char * names
Reviewed by: Yuri Pankov <ypankov@fastmail.com>
Reviewed by: Patrick Mooney <pmooney@pfmooney.com>
Reviewed by: Toomas Soo

12508 ndi_devi_alloc() and friends could take const char * names
Reviewed by: Yuri Pankov <ypankov@fastmail.com>
Reviewed by: Patrick Mooney <pmooney@pfmooney.com>
Reviewed by: Toomas Soome <tsoome@me.com>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# 30c304d9 02-Apr-2020 Joshua M. Clulow

7119 boot should handle change in physical path to ZFS root devices
Reviewed by: Toomas Soome <tsoome@me.com>
Approved by: Dan McDonald <danmcd@joyent.com>


# c6f039c7 26-Dec-2019 Toomas Soome

12172 genunix: variable may be used uninitialized
Reviewed by: John Levon <john.levon@joyent.com>
Reviewed by: Andy Stormont <astormont@racktopsystems.com>
Approved by: Dan McDonald <danm

12172 genunix: variable may be used uninitialized
Reviewed by: John Levon <john.levon@joyent.com>
Reviewed by: Andy Stormont <astormont@racktopsystems.com>
Approved by: Dan McDonald <danmcd@joyent.com>

show more ...


# 48bbca81 17-Feb-2017 Daniel Hoffman

7812 Remove gender specific language
Reviewed by: Matt Ahrens <mahrens@delphix.com>
Reviewed by: Prakash Surya <prakash.surya@delphix.com>
Reviewed by: Steve Gonczi <steve.gonczi@delphix.

7812 Remove gender specific language
Reviewed by: Matt Ahrens <mahrens@delphix.com>
Reviewed by: Prakash Surya <prakash.surya@delphix.com>
Reviewed by: Steve Gonczi <steve.gonczi@delphix.com>
Reviewed by: Chris Williamson <chris.williamson@delphix.com>
Reviewed by: George Wilson <george.wilson@delphix.com>
Reviewed by: Igor Kozhukhov <igor@dilos.org>
Reviewed by: Dan McDonald <danmcd@omniti.com>
Reviewed by: Robert Mustacchi <rm@joyent.com>
Approved by: Richard Lowe <richlowe@richlowe.net>

show more ...


# 1a5e258f 08-Aug-2014 Josef 'Jeff' Sipek

5045 use atomic_{inc,dec}_* instead of atomic_add_*
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Garrett D'Amore <garrett@damore.org>
Approved by: Robert Mustacchi <rm@j

5045 use atomic_{inc,dec}_* instead of atomic_add_*
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Garrett D'Amore <garrett@damore.org>
Approved by: Robert Mustacchi <rm@joyent.com>

show more ...


# 39cddb10 11-Sep-2013 Joshua M. Clulow

4128 disks in zpools never go away when pulled
Reviewed by: Keith Wesolowski <keith.wesolowski@joyent.com>
Reviewed by: Bill Pijewski <wdp@joyent.com>
Reviewed by: Marcel Telka <marcel.te

4128 disks in zpools never go away when pulled
Reviewed by: Keith Wesolowski <keith.wesolowski@joyent.com>
Reviewed by: Bill Pijewski <wdp@joyent.com>
Reviewed by: Marcel Telka <marcel.telka@nexenta.com>
Approved by: Eric Schrock <eric.schrock@delphix.com>

show more ...


# cd21e7c5 12-Mar-2012 Garrett D'Amore

998 obsolete DMA driver interfaces should be removed
Reviewed by: Igor Khozhukhov <igor.khozhukhov@nexenta.com>
Reviewed by: Albert Lee <trisk@nexenta.com>
Reviewed by: Robert Mustacchi <

998 obsolete DMA driver interfaces should be removed
Reviewed by: Igor Khozhukhov <igor.khozhukhov@nexenta.com>
Reviewed by: Albert Lee <trisk@nexenta.com>
Reviewed by: Robert Mustacchi <rm@joyent.com>
Reviewed by: Richard Lowe <richlowe@richlowe.net>
Approved by: Robert Mustacchi <rm@joyent.com>

show more ...


# 15e1afcd 03-Mar-2012 Richard Lowe

backout 998: breaks common closed drivers


# 88b44bf4 01-Mar-2012 Garrett D'Amore

998 obsolete DMA driver interfaces should be removed
Reviewed by: Igor Khozhukhov <igor.khozhukhov@nexenta.com>
Reviewed by: Albert Lee <trisk@nexenta.com>
Reviewed by: Robert Mustacchi <

998 obsolete DMA driver interfaces should be removed
Reviewed by: Igor Khozhukhov <igor.khozhukhov@nexenta.com>
Reviewed by: Albert Lee <trisk@nexenta.com>
Reviewed by: Robert Mustacchi <rm@joyent.com>
Approved by: Richard Lowe <richlowe@richlowe.net>

show more ...


# 1c79aca5 26-Jan-2012 Alexander Eremin

1779 panic: assertion failed: rc == DDI_SUCCESS, file: ../../common/os/devcfg.c, line: 4185
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com>
Reviewed by: Dan Kruchinin <dkruchinin@acm.org>

1779 panic: assertion failed: rc == DDI_SUCCESS, file: ../../common/os/devcfg.c, line: 4185
Reviewed by: Yuri Pankov <yuri.pankov@nexenta.com>
Reviewed by: Dan Kruchinin <dkruchinin@acm.org>
Reviewed by: Milan Jurik <milan.jurik@xylab.cz>
Reviewed by: Michael Speer <michael.speer@pluribusnetworks.com>
Reviewed by: Igor Kozhukhov <ikozhukhov@gmail.com>
Reviewed by: Alexander Stetsenko <ams@nexenta.com>
Reviewed by: Bayard Bell <buffer.g.overflow@gmail.com>
Reviewed by: Garrett D'Amore <garrett@damore.org>
Approved by: Richard Lowe <richlowe@richlowe.net>

show more ...


# 6a634c9d 19-Aug-2010 Richard Lowe

merge with onnv_147
Reviewed by: garrett@nexenta.com
Approved by: garrett@nexenta.com


# 50200e77 09-Aug-2010 Frank Van Der Linden

6955192 Intel IOMMU code performs unnecessary write buffer flushes
6955196 Intel IOMMU code should use higher-level abstraction interface
6955973 Intel IOMMU code has too many checks in the d

6955192 Intel IOMMU code performs unnecessary write buffer flushes
6955196 Intel IOMMU code should use higher-level abstraction interface
6955973 Intel IOMMU code has too many checks in the dma bind handle path
6956536 Intel iommu code does too much work during cookie manipulation
6955206 iommulib code looks up nexops too often
6949020 iommulib should not get used when disabled from rootnex.conf

show more ...


# 8451e9c3 05-Aug-2010 Gavin Maltby

6972597 SAS2+max-toro : panic at e_devid_cache_devi_path_lists ()


# 779f1d69 28-Jun-2010 Michael Bergknoff

6954356 picld(1M) doesn't receive the device removal event after hotplug disable command
6959155 4964150 fix broke event processing


# e58a33b6 14-Jun-2010 Stephen Hanson

6935604 io-retire should prevent attach of faulty persistent devices
6930157 Remove fmadm's reliance on taking topo snapshots
6881991 SMART faults could preserve asc/ascq in fault payload

6935604 io-retire should prevent attach of faulty persistent devices
6930157 Remove fmadm's reliance on taking topo snapshots
6881991 SMART faults could preserve asc/ascq in fault payload
6955664 eversholt matching should not be performed for scsi-device nodes
6958085 defect.sunos.fmd.module not visible via fmadm faulty
6958856 fmd performance issue if "fmstat -m" called while disgnosis going on

show more ...


# c8742f64 08-Jun-2010 Jerry Gilliam

6955559 ddi_driver_name() returns NULL to e_ddi_free_instance(), leading to a bad trap panic in in_drvwalk()


# bccb2643 07-May-2010 Jerry Gilliam

6949932 ddi_alias_to_currdip() and ddi_strdup() leaks


# 328d222b 29-Apr-2010 Chris Horne

6947388 SCSAv3: generate LDI DEVICE_REMOVE events on device_remove
6948076 instance code makes assumptions about promotion ordering of preassigns.


# 39f19891 12-Apr-2010 Reed

6898776 assertion failed: DEVI(self)->devi_ref, file: ../../common/io/scsi/impl/scsi_hba.c, line: 7710


# 4f1e984d 09-Apr-2010 Reed

6933787 scsav3: for mpxio, devid should be registered/transferred to client node


1234